接下来会调用在内核启动时设备驱动注册的对应的中断服务程序(ISR)。软件中断也可以被特殊的指令所调用,来读取或写入数据到硬件设备。当系统需要实时性时(例如在工业应用中),软件中断会变得重要。table(IDT)中记录了中断请求(IRQ)和中断服务程序(ISR)的对应关系。正确的中断请求(IRQ)处理对于硬件、驱动和软件的正常交互是必要的。的普通用户几乎不会注意到内核的整个中断处理过程。
接下来会调用在内核启动时设备驱动注册的对应的中断服务程序(ISR)。软件中断也可以被特殊的指令所调用,来读取或写入数据到硬件设备。当系统需要实时性时(例如在工业应用中),软件中断会变得重要。table(IDT)中记录了中断请求(IRQ)和中断服务程序(ISR)的对应关系。正确的中断请求(IRQ)处理对于硬件、驱动和软件的正常交互是必要的。的普通用户几乎不会注意到内核的整个中断处理过程。